CPZ may be introduced on street by street basis even if majority vote against

'The results of the consultation, combined with the views of the community council and the parking occupancy surveys will help determine whether or not a CPZ is introduced (subject to second stage consultation) in some or all of the area.

If a decision is made to go ahead with introducing a CPZ, we will carry out a second consultation with all residents and businesses in the roads concerned to determine the final parking layout before works begin.'

In favour as long as it's only 2 hours a day




We’re in FAVOUR as long as it’s just a couple of hours each day to knock out commuter parking.

Just the stage we’re at I guess, but when arriving home with three kids and general clutter we want to park near our home.

On our road I’d guess c.25% of the spaces are used each day by non-residents.
